React functional component props typescript
WebReact components use props to communicate with each other. Every parent component can pass some information to its child components by giving them props. Props might remind you of HTML attributes, but you can pass any JavaScript value through them, including objects, arrays, and functions. You will learn How to pass props to a component WebSep 23, 2024 · react typescript The React children prop allows components to be composed together and is a key concept for building reusable components. Visually, we can think of it as a hole in the component where the consumer controls what is rendered. This post covers different approaches to strongly-typing this powerful and flexible prop with TypeScript.
React functional component props typescript
Did you know?
WebApr 12, 2024 · 1 function withThings(Component: React.ComponentType) typescript In this case, the signature specifies that the props, generic type T, extends the ThingsProps interface, meaning that any component passed into this function must implement that interface in its props. WebApr 12, 2024 · import React from "react"; type ValueType = number [] string [] number string interface ISelectChipProps { value: X setValue: (value: X) => void } const SelectChip = ( { value, setValue, }: ISelectChipProps) => { return ( <> ) } interface IFilterProps { value: number [], setValue: (value: number []) => void } const Filter = ( {setValue, …
WebExample: react functional component typescript import React from 'react'; interface Props { } export const App: React.FC = (props) => { return ( <> WebApr 10, 2024 · デ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エンドに一歩近づこう. こんにちは。. ひらやま( @rhirayamaaan )です。. 先日とあるツイートを見 …
WebTypeScript sees a function as functional component as long as it returns JSX. There are multiple solutions to define props for functional components. Function components Typing regular function components is as easy as adding … WebMar 31, 2024 · Use component state and props to handle most UI updates. Overusing refs in stateless components. Functional components are often meant to be simple and …
WebMar 9, 2024 · Functional React components with generic props in TypeScript. One of the qualities of our code that we should aim for is reusability. Also, following the D on’t R …
WebMar 31, 2024 · react-scripts: 5.0.1 devDependencies @babel/runtime: 7.13.8 typescript: 4.1.3 In the code above, we defined a ref in the component that needs the ref and passed it to the button component. React passed the ref through and forwarded it down to by specifying it as a JSX attribute. greggs office suppliesWebJul 16, 2024 · To get up and running, let’s create a new React-TypeScript project directory with the popular generator, Create React App. The following command will install the basic type libraries for React, give us a few scripts for testing and building, and give us a default tsconfig file. npx create-react-app my-app --template typescript greggs officeWebAug 25, 2024 · One of the ways you can define props is simply by defining them in the parameter list of a function as demonstrated above. For example: 1 interface FullName { … greggs north end portsmouthWebTypeScript ships with three JSX modes: preserve, react, and react-native . These modes only affect the emit stage - type checking is unaffected. The preserve mode will keep the JSX … greggs official siteWebSep 29, 2024 · then TypeScript will warn about that. 2.2 children prop. children is a special prop in React components: it holds the content between the opening and closing tag … greggs north shieldsWebJul 16, 2024 · To get up and running, let’s create a new React-TypeScript project directory with the popular generator, Create React App. The following command will install the … greggs of gosforthWebNov 26, 2024 · It combines your function component with PureComponent ’s shallow comparer. You can even provide your own comparer to it for advanced optimization. The code below is one of the many ways to write... greggs old hollywood cake